What is the shortcut for getting to the beginning of the cell and the end of
the cell? -- Tammy |

When in Edit mode...........Home or End

If you are actively editing, (curson in the formula bar) then END takes you
to the end of you typing buffer and HOME takes you to the beginning -- Gary''s Student - gsnu200850 "Tammyp" wrote: What is the shortcut for getting to the beginning of the cell and the end of the cell? -- Tammy |
